So, you know, like, what exactly do they do?
And how do they do in a group setting? Can one person of the group use the loot boost and the loot is better no matter who kills/loots the critters as long as the boosted person helped? Or does the boosted person have to kill/loot the critter?
And does the loot cap affect loot boosts? So like if you're at the loot cap then using a boost is pointless?
Winter
02-05-2023, 02:09 PM
The person who used the boost has to do the looting, and as far as I know they just speed up how quickly you reach the cap.

Loot boosts are still quite useful for pay quests like Reim, Troubled Waters, and Night at the Academy. Those DO NOT count against your loot cap (or so they claim!) and thus you can maximize your $$$->Silver generation with loot boosts during those.
